The need for speed again.
Just keep practicing those single strokes, doubles, paradiddles etc while your are watching tv. Just remember that speed isn't always the key to be a good drummer. Also try practicing those crossovers really slow for an hour or two. it helps other hand muscles to loosen up. i always practice the one hit per drum approach for crossovers. the more drums you have the better. try it. once you get it up to speed it sounds and looks mighty cool, the way Virgil does it on his cymbals...my god! |
AC is right about the importance of speed.
Echo what he says about the crossovers OR ANY OTHER pattern that you're working. The truth is that the slower you go, the better you will get! :) |
